means a wave pattern where crests and troughs stay fixed in space because two identical waves traveling opposite directions cancel and reinforce each other in the same spots.

from formalized in 19th-century acoustics and later in quantum mechanics, but you've heard one: pluck a guitar string, and the fixed ends force the wave to interfere with its own reflection, freezing the pattern in place.
